Berkeley Square is a mellow gin, with subdued notes of juniper and a distinct yet delicious herbal quality. Not only tasty in a G&T, it can count itself as one of those gins that would be great drunk neat over ice.
The result is that Berkeley Square has a depth of flavour and perfect balance that allows for this subtle gin to really release all of its character. By no means bad in a G&T, it is not at it’s best when served with tonic. It does however, provide a very different proposition when making cocktails as the herbal elements shine through. For these reasons we recommend trying it in cocktails like The Last Word or for those who like the medicinal notes of Campari – in a Negroni.
